VPN Guides: What is a VPN?

A VPN, or Virtual Private Network, is a powerful tool that establishes a secure connection between your device and the internet. By routing your internet traffic through a VPN server, it encrypts your data and masks your IP address, ensuring your online activities remain private and anonymous.

VPNs operate by creating a secure tunnel between your device and the VPN server. When you connect to the internet through a VPN, your data passes through this encrypted tunnel, preventing anyone from intercepting or monitoring your online activities.

  • Enhanced Security: VPNs add an extra layer of encryption to your data, making it nearly impossible for hackers or malicious entities to access your personal information.
  • Privacy Protection: With a VPN, your IP address is hidden, and your online activities are not directly tied to your real identity, ensuring your privacy remains intact.
  • Bypass Geo-restrictions: VPNs allow you to access content and websites that may be restricted or blocked in your region, giving you unrestricted internet access.
  • Public Wi-Fi Safety: When using public Wi-Fi networks, a VPN ensures that your data remains secure, protecting you from potential cyber threats.

Types of VPNs: Exploring the Options

VPNs come in various types, each catering to different needs and use cases. Let's explore the most common types of VPNs available:

Remote Access VPNs are designed for individual users who need to access their organization's network securely from a remote location. These are ideal for remote employees and businesses with a distributed workforce.

Site-to-Site VPNs, also known as Router-to-Router VPNs, connect multiple networks in different locations securely. They are commonly used by businesses to establish secure communication between various office locations.

Mobile VPNs are tailored for mobile device users, ensuring a secure connection even when using public Wi-Fi networks. These VPNs are essential for travelers and individuals who frequently connect to the internet using their smartphones or tablets.

Business VPNs are designed to meet the unique security and privacy needs of businesses. They often come with additional features like centralized management and multi-user support.

While free VPNs may seem enticing, they often come with limitations in terms of speed, bandwidth, and security. Paid VPNs, on the other hand, offer premium features, faster speeds, and better security, making them a more reliable option for serious users.

How to Choose the Right VPN: Factors to Consider

Choosing the perfect VPN can be overwhelming with the plethora of options available. Here are some essential factors to consider before making your decision:

Ensure the VPN you choose offers robust encryption protocols and follows strict security practices to keep your data safe from potential threats.

More server locations mean better access to geo-restricted content and improved performance. As an example, it could be beneficial if you want to change your location on Amazon Prime Video, to consider a VPN with servers in your desired locations.

If you have multiple devices, opt for a VPN that allows simultaneous connections on multiple devices without additional charges.

A user-friendly VPN client makes setup and usage more convenient, especially for beginners.

Reliable customer support can be crucial when you encounter any issues with your VPN. Look for providers offering 24/7 customer support.

A strict no-logs policy ensures that your online activities are not stored or monitored, providing enhanced privacy.

For seamless streaming and downloading, choose a VPN that offers high-speed connections and ample bandwidth.
